TRANSFER OF INFORMATION TO THE U.S. AND OTHER COUNTRIES
EMVCo is based in the United States and we process and store information in the U.S. As such, we and our service providers may transfer your information to, or store or access it in, jurisdictions that may not provide equivalent levels of data protection as your home jurisdiction. We will take steps to ensure that your personal data receives an adequate level of protection in the jurisdictions in which we process it.
If you are in the European Economic Area, one of the methods we use to provide adequate protection for the transfer of personal data to countries outside of the EEA is through a series of intercompany agreements based on the Standard Contractual Clauses authorized under EU law. You are entitled to obtain a copy of these agreements by contacting us using the contact information below.
When we transfer personal data from the European Union to the United States, we comply with the EU-U.S. Data Privacy Framework, the UK Extension to the EU-U.S. Data Privacy Framework, and the Swiss-U.S. Data Privacy Framework, each as set forth by the U.S. Department of Commerce regarding the collection, use, and retention of personal data transferred from the European Union, Switzerland, and the United Kingdom to the United States, respectively. EMVCo has certified to the Department of Commerce that it adheres to the Data Privacy Framework Principles with regard to the processing of personal data received from the European Union, Switzerland, and the United Kingdom in reliance on the EU-U.S. Data Privacy Framework, the Swiss-U.S. Data Privacy Framework, and the UK Extension to the EU-U.S. Data Privacy Framework. To learn more about the Data Privacy Framework program, and to view our certification, please visit https://www.dataprivacyframework.gov/s/.
In compliance with the Data Privacy Framework Principles, we are committed to resolving complaints about our processing of information about you. EU, Swiss, and UK individuals with inquiries or complaints regarding our compliance with the Data Privacy Framework program should first contact us. We have further committed to refer unresolved Data Privacy Framework complaints to JAMS, an alternative dispute resolution provider located in the United States. If you do not receive timely acknowledgment of your complaint from us, or if we have not addressed your complaint to your satisfaction, please contact or visit https://www.jamsadr.com/dpf-dispute-resolution for more information or to file a complaint. The services of JAMS are provided at no cost to you.
Under certain conditions, you may be able to invoke binding arbitration to resolve your complaint. EMVCo is subject to the investigatory and enforcement powers of the Federal Trade Commission. If we disclose personal data transferred to the U.S. under the Data Privacy Framework with a third-party service provider that processes such data on our behalf, then we will be liable for that third party’s processing in violation of the Data Privacy Framework Principles, unless we can prove that we are not responsible for the event giving rise to the damage.

ADDITIONAL DISCLOSURES FOR INDIVIDUALS IN EUROPE
If you are a resident of the European Economic Area, the United Kingdom (“UK”) or Switzerland, you have certain rights and protections under the law regarding the processing of your personal data.
Legal Basis for Processing
When we process your personal data, we will only do so in the following situations:
- We need to use your personal data to perform our responsibilities under a contract with you such as processing payments for providing the EMVCo services you have requested.
- We need to use your personal data to comply with legal obligations we have such as satisfying export control list requirements.
- We have a legitimate interest in processing your personal data. For example, we may process your personal data to send you informational emails, to communicate with you about changes to our web sites and services, and to provide, secure, and improve our web sites and services.
- We have your consent to do so. When consent is the lawful basis for our processing, you may withdraw such consent at any time.
Data Subject Rights Requests
You have the right to access personal data we hold about you and to ask that your personal data be corrected, erased, or transferred. You may also have the right to object to, or request that we restrict, certain processing. If you would like to exercise any of these rights, you can log into your EMVCo account.
